Ivoire White Chocolate Beans 35%

Valrhona’s iconic white chocolate. Balanced and lightly sweetened, with notes of cooked milk and vanilla.

Ivoire 35% is Valrhona’s iconic white chocolate. A lightly sweetened white chocolate (just 43% sugar), it reveals hot milk aromas enhanced by delicate vanilla notes. Its carefully balanced composition (minimum 35% cocoa, 40% fat, 22% milk) gives it a melt-in-the-mouth texture and a pearlescent hue. Its balanced sweetness makes it an ideal base for pairings with red berries, citrus fruits and exotic fruits.

6Tempering curve

The official Valrhona curve for this chocolate.

1
Melting

40–45°C

Bain-marie or microwave in stages
2
Cooling

26–27°C

Crystallisation of the right crystals
3
Working

28–29°C

Ideal moulding temperature

Tip: To simplify the process, use Mycryo cocoa butter (1% of the chocolate’s weight) added at 34–35°C. A fast, reliable tempering method favoured by professionals.

What is couverture chocolate?

Couverture chocolate is chocolate with a high cocoa butter content (generally more than 31%) intended for professionals. Its fluidity enables coating, molding, and all fine chocolate-making techniques.

Is tempering required?

For uses where the chocolate remains visible and solid (molding, coating, decoration): yes, tempering is essential for shine, snap, and shelf life. For uses where it is mixed in (mousses, ganaches, biscuits): not required; simple melting is sufficient.

How many fèves are in 100g?

Approximately 35 to 40 Valrhona fèves per 100g. A practical format for measuring to the nearest gram without weighing once you are used to it.

How should Valrhona chocolate be stored?

Ideally at 16–18°C, in a dry place protected from light and odors. Avoid the refrigerator (condensation = chocolate bloom). In a resealed bag, it keeps for 18 months.
